New Features in the 2022 release of Autodesk InfraWorks

Highlights

Decorations for Component and Corridor Roads New Vegetation Content Complex 3D Girders Refined Bridge Analysis
Added Road Decorations for component roads and corridor roads brought in from Civil 3D. Added new Vegetation content. You can now use complex 3D Girders for bridge construction. Create Robot Structural Analysis bridge models in addition to Structural Bridge Design bridge models.

Bridges and Tunnels
  • Pan and selection is faster.
  • The Civil Structures Revit workflow now uses a shared parameters file, so that multiple people working in revti can share and define the same properties. The Autodesk Revit InfraWorks Updater plugin will now ask for a shared parameters file when importing an IMX from InfraWorks, if one has not already been assigned.
  • Autodesk Structural Bridge Design and Robot Structural Analysis Integration
    • Update steel girders from Autodesk Structural Bridge Design.
    • Create, open, and update a Robot Structural Analysis bridge model from Autodesk Structural Bridge Design.
    • Specify material properties, section properties, alignment, and grid lines to a Robot Structural Analysis bridge model from Autodesk Structural Bridge Design.
  • Added the ability to update slice offsets to a spreadsheet and apply them in InfraWorks.
Decorations
  • Add to Library on Component Roads now captures linear decoration attachment and includes those decorations in the assembly to be added to library.
  • A message bar will be displayed upon selection of legacy decorations informing the user that "This is an old version of decoration that must be converted before editing. Right-click to view conversion options." After the action is finished, the message bar informs the user of successful conversion.
  • Decoration's gaps react to road change through intersections and roundabouts.
  • Linear decorations that are not associated with a road now have an attach command on the decoration context menu. Free decorations can occur either through creating free form decorations from the InfraWorks toolbar glyph Create glyph Environment glyph Linear Decoration command or by orphaning a decoration by removing the data source of the parent road. Attach allows the user to associate the decoration with a road seam.
  • Linear Decoration has been added to the Create glyph Environment section of the InfraWorks toolbar. Enables the user to create unattached free form linear decorations independent of a road alignment.
Collaboration
  • Now uses Autodesk Docs for model collaboration.
  • Full support for Autodesk Construction Cloud (ACC) projects. In InfraWorks, every mention of BIM360 has been changed to refer to "Autodesk Docs".
General
  • Profile View does not cause an issue when zooming and panning from the very left side to the right.
  • Names displayed in the Style Palette for new Models are user friendly.
  • Added new vegetation content to the Infraworks content library: * Bushes (3) * Flowers (17) * Hedges (3) * Meadow (3) * Grass (6)
  • Hovering over a feature with a tooltip shows the tooltip. Double clicking on the feature with link opens the link (e.g. in a web browser).
